    About Krešimir

    Krešimir carries a distinctly regal and historical weight, perfect for parents who appreciate a name with deep roots and a powerful, yet peaceful, meaning. Evoking "rouse peace," it’s a name that suggests a leader who inspires tranquility rather than commands it. While its sound is undeniably strong, it maintains a gentle undercurrent, making it a unique choice that stands apart from more common royal monikers. This is a name that feels both ancient and enduringly relevant, particularly resonant for families with ties to Croatian or Bosnian heritage, where Krešimir has long been a mark of significant cultural and historical identity.
